To find the monthly interest rate from a yearly interest rate, you divide the yearly interest rate by the number of months in a year.

Given that the yearly interest rate is 30%, we can express it as a decimal:

\[
30\% = 0.30
\]

Now, divide this by 12 (the number of months in a year):

\[
\text{Monthly Interest Rate} = \frac{0.30}{12} = 0.025
\]

So, the monthly interest rate is \(0.025\) as a decimal.
